Casa Pia AC, a Portuguese top-flight team, wants to add Abdul Fatawu Issahaku, a Ghanaian international, to their attack this summer.
Since joining Sporting Lisbon, the 19-year-old has failed to establish himself as an important player.
After being cycled at the club the previous season, he only played in 12 games for the senior team.
Issahaku has become a major transfer target for a number of clubs, including Casa Pia AC, which is interested in signing the Ghanaian youngster on a loan.
The Black Meteors star is up for sale, but the Portuguese giants won’t take any offer for him that is less than 15 million euros. The club prefers a sale to a loan and wants to maintain 20% of any future sales.
The ‘Green and Whites’ are scheduled to let Issahaku out of his contract on June 30, 2027.
The resourceful winger, meanwhile, has been barred from Sporting’s preseason training camp in Portugal’s Algarve.
After his holidays in Ghana, he will train with the second squad when he returns to the European nation.
